Understanding Submersible Pumps for Wells


Submersible pumps have become a popular choice for extracting water from wells, thanks to their efficiency and versatility. These pumps are designed to operate underwater, and they play a critical role in various applications, including agricultural irrigation, residential water supply, and industrial processes. In this article, we will explore the functionality, advantages, and considerations associated with submersible pumps for well use.


What is a Submersible Pump?


A submersible pump is a type of centrifugal pump that is installed below the water level. Its design features a hermetically sealed motor close-coupled to the pump body, allowing it to operate submerged in the fluid it needs to pump. This setup helps to reduce the risk of damage from flooding and minimizes the need for aggressive priming.


How Do Submersible Pumps Work?


Submersible pumps function by converting electrical energy into mechanical energy to move water from the well to the surface. When the motor starts, it rotates an impeller, which creates a centrifugal force that pushes water upwards through the pump’s discharge head. This process allows the pump to operate efficiently even at significant depths, typically ranging from 100 feet to over 1,000 feet, depending on the pump's design and purpose.


Advantages of Submersible Pumps


1. Efficiency Submersible pumps are generally more efficient than their surface counterparts. Since they are submerged, they do not rely on suction to lift water, which minimizes energy losses associated with cavitation.


2. Space-saving Because they are installed underwater, submersible pumps save space and reduce noise compared to external pumps. This is particularly beneficial in residential settings where a quiet atmosphere is desired.


3. Versatility These pumps can handle a variety of fluid types, including muddy or sandy water, making them suitable for a wide range of applications. They can also be used for drainage, sewage pumping, and even in mining operations.

4. Durability Most submersible pumps are designed with corrosion-resistant materials, making them capable of withstanding harsh conditions and extending their lifespan.


Considerations When Choosing a Submersible Pump


When selecting a submersible pump for a well, several factors should be taken into account to ensure optimal performance


1. Well Depth The depth of the well will largely dictate the type of pump required. It's essential to choose a pump that can effectively lift water from that depth, considering the vertical lift capability.


2. Flow Rate Determine the flow rate required for your application. This measurement indicates how fast water needs to be pumped and will influence the horsepower and size of the pump.


3. Water Quality If the well water contains sediment or other particulate matter, ensure the pump is designed to handle such conditions. Filters or specialized impellers may be necessary.


4. Power Source Submersible pumps typically run on electric power, but options are available for solar-powered units. Consider what power source is most feasible and sustainable for your needs.


5. Installation and Maintenance Installing a submersible pump can require specialized skills and tools. It's essential to factor in installation costs and ongoing maintenance needs when making a decision.
